The 34-seat Chef’s Tasting Room is Chef Armstrong’s culinary showcase. Here, Armstrong features a five, seven, and nine-course prix-fixe tasting menu, priced at $120, $135, and $150 respectively. The courses are headed: Creation (palate teasers), Ocean (seafood), Earth & Sky (meats and game), Age (cheese) and Eden (desserts). The Tasting Room menu changes daily as there are many farmers markets in the area. Keeping true to the SEASON, if it be summer, highlights include Heirloom Tomato Tart with Garden Basil grown from the restaurant’s own organic garden and Butter Poached Maine Lobster with Eastern Shore Corn. Keeping true to the MISSION, the menu features delectable sustainable meat entrées such as The Hogs Head “Banger” and Polyface Farm 100% Pasture Fed Beef Ribeye.
